Purpose

  • Ni-Cr-Co-Mo solid wire (alloy 617) for high-temperature service, with cobalt for creep resistance.
  • Joining alloy 617 and dissimilar heat-resisting alloys (800H/HP, 803).

Why it works

Cobalt (12%) is what sets this alloy apart from the rest of this datasheet's NiCr family — together with molybdenum (9%), it specifically improves creep resistance at sustained high temperature, the critical property in furnace and turbine components running for thousands of hours near the material's thermal limit.

Fields of application

  • Joining alloy 617 in high-temperature components (furnaces, turbines).
  • Dissimilar welding with heat-resisting alloys 800H/HP and 803.

Advantages

  • Cobalt (12%) for creep resistance at sustained high temperature — a property this datasheet's other NiCr alloys don't offer.
  • High toughness (KV 120 J) while maintaining mechanical strength (Rm 750 MPa).

Limitations

  • An alloy specific to sustained high-temperature service — overkill for general-purpose joints.
